At the end of this day,
I will assess the value,
of what I've gained,
for what I've paid.
I paid a day of my life,
a very high price indeed.
I pray that my investment,
was worth it.
Too often I have found,
my accountancy in the red,
paying the cost of life,
and not capitalizing on it.
I've paid at the door,
and have wandered aimlessly,
wasting, in true American fashion.
As I review my ledger tonight,
will I find I have misspent,
this day I've bought?
Will I find I ignored,
the chance to make a difference?
Will I find I avoided,
the opportunity to be of import?
Will I find that my payment,
has gone unreturned?
Tomorrow comes soon,
and I pray that I realize,
that I am bankrupting my soul,
and that I fight to see a profit,
worth the inflated cost of life.
